The difference between the Cavs and Raptors RIGHT NOW are two reasons, IMO. The bigger reason is head coaching. At the end of the day, the Cavs still have a decent coach in Byron Scott who knows what he's doing and has been to the finals before. Who the hell is the Raptors coach? I had to look it up. Jay Triano. You know him? Of course you don't. He never even played in the NBA.
The other reason, although not as influential is the Cavs still had a semi-decent group of players leftover that at least have the late-season experience and know what winning feels like. Mo, Varejao, Jamison, Moon, Gibson have all been there for a year or two or more, so at least there is still that nucleus. Granted they're in a different situation with different expectations on them, but at least not everything is completely new to them.
